Types of Commercial Door Locks

Understanding the different kinds of commercial door locks readily available can assist entrepreneur in picking the best lock for their needs. Below are commonly used locks in commercial settings:

Deadbolts

  • Provides extra locking security.
  • Available in single and double-cylinder versions.

Smart Locks

  • Run via electronic keypads or smartphones.
  • Offer features like remote gain access to and tracking.

Lever Handle Locks

  • Typically discovered in commercial areas, simple to operate.
  • Can be utilized with deadbolts for added security.

Mortise Locks

  • Installed into a pocket cut out of the door.
  • Normally more robust and secure than standard cylindrical locks.

High-Security Locks

  • Designed to withstand tampering and choosing.
  • Control key duplication to boost security.

Frequently Asked Questions About Commercial Door Lock Replacement

1. How frequently should I replace my commercial door locks?

The suggestion is to replace locks every 5-7 years, however this may vary based on wear and tear, security incidents, or changes in staff.

3. What is the cost of replacing commercial door locks?

Expenses differ commonly depending upon the kind of lock selected, installation complexity, and whether expert help is used. Expect to invest anywhere from ₤ 20 to over ₤ 500.

4. What should I think about when choosing a lock?

Consider security level, innovation (e.g., electronic vs. mechanical), cost, and compatibility with your existing door infrastructure.

5. Are smart locks worth the investment?

For numerous organizations, smart locks provide improved security and benefit, permitting remote monitoring and access control, making them a worthy investment.
